How they compare
Luxembourg currently reports 28.6% against 27.0% in Germany, a difference of 1.6%.
That makes Luxembourg's figure about 1.1 times Germany's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 11 shared years of data; in 2015 it was Germany ahead.
Germany ranks 7th and Luxembourg ranks 6th of 35 countries.
Luxembourg has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Germany | Luxembourg |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2010s | 37.6% | 41.5% | 3.9% | Luxembourg |
| 2020s | 28.8% | 33.9% | 5.1% | Luxembourg |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
